High Value Target: The Hunt For Saddam - Premiere Date and Trailer Revealed!

TNT has released the trailer and premiere date for the limited series High Value Target: The Hunt For Saddam, starring Joel Kinnaman. The show, based on the memoir Debriefing the President by CIA Analyst John Nixon, will debut with its first two episodes on Sunday, September 13 at 9 p.m. ET/PT. The third episode will air on Monday, September 14 at 9 p.m. ET/PT, with subsequent episodes airing on Sundays and Mondays, leading up to the finale on Sunday, October 4 on TNT.
High Value Target: The Hunt For Saddam follows John Nixon (played by Kinnaman), the first CIA officer to interrogate Saddam Hussein (played by Waleed Zuaiter) after his capture in December 2003. The series delves into the intense exchanges between Nixon and Hussein as Nixon seeks information about weapons of mass destruction and grapples with the consequences of the U.S. invasion of Iraq.
The ensemble cast of the series includes Waleed Zuaiter, Lena Góra, Rebecca Night, Tom Berenger, Paul Ryan, Christopher McDonald, Dar Salim, Matt Barr, Ewan Miller, and Talia Balsam. Created by Daniel Stiepleman and Jonathan Wakeham, the show is written by Leslie Greif, Graham Sack, Daniel Stiepleman, and Jonathan Wakeham. The executive producers include Alexander Rodnyansky, Jason Sarlanis, Sam Linsky, Stuart Manashil, Michael Kupisk, Tamer Mortada, and Leslie Greif.
